CISP共有共包括信息安全保障、信息安全技术、信息安全管理、信息安全工程和信息安全标准法规五个知识类,希赛网CISP教材大纲栏目,为大家整理了CISP知识点梳理,详情如下:
7.1.2对称密码算法
对称密码算法也称为传统密码算法、秘密密钥算法或单密钥算法,其加密密钥能够从解密密钥中推算出来,反过来也成立
1.算法特点
优点:
算法简单、计算量小、加密速度快、加密效率高,适合加密大量数据,明文长度与密文长度相等
缺点:
(1)需要通过秘密的安全信道协商加密密钥,这种安全信道可能很难实现
(2)密钥管理难
(3)无法解决对消息的篡改、否认等问题
对称密码分为分组密码算法和流密码算法
典型的分组密码包括DES、IDEA、AES、RC5、Twofish、CAST-256、MARS等
2.DES和3DES
数据加密标准(Data Encryption Standard,DES),是迄今为止世界上使用最为广泛的一种密码算法,它对分析、掌握分组密码的基本原理和设计原理有着重要的意义
(1)DES选定过程
美国标准局采用了IBM公司提交的Luciffer算法的改进版本
DES设计中使用了分组密码设计的两个基本原则:混淆和扩散原则
(2)DES算法过程
(3)DES与3DES
两个密钥合起来有效密钥长度有112比特
3.AES
高级加密标准(Advanced Encryption Standard,AES)
(1)AES选定过程
AES的基本要求是比三重DES快而且至少和三重DES一样安全,分组长度为128比特,密钥长度为128/192/256比特
(2)AES算法过程
4.其他算法
(1)RC4算法
(2)BlowFish算法
(3)IDEA算法
国际数据加密算法(International Data Encryption Algorithm,IDEA)
注:以上内容来源于网络,如有侵权,可联系客服删除
查看更多:CISP知识点整理第七章汇总